The Pensions Increase (Scottish Parliamentary Pension Scheme) Regulations 2000
Made
8th March 2000
Laid before Parliament
9th March 2000
Coming into force
30th March 2000
Citation and commencement
1. These Regulations may be cited as the Pensions Increase (Scottish Parliamentary Pension Scheme) Regulations 2000, and shall come into force on 30th March 2000, but shall take effect as specified in regulation 3.
Interpretation
2. In these Regulations:
βthe 1971 Actβ means the Pensions (Increase) Act 1971;
βpensionβ means a pension within the meaning of the 1971 Act.
Pensions to which the 1971 Act will apply
3. With effect from 21st December 1999, the 1971 Act shall apply to any pensions payable under the Scottish Parliamentary Pension Scheme( 3 ) as if they were pensions specified in Part II of Schedule 2 to the 1971 Act.
